Where No Man has Gone Before: Women and Science Fiction, edited by Lucie Armitt, is a 1991 anthology of critical essays on women an science fiction.

Publications

  • New York: Routledge, 1991. Anthology.

Contents

  • Introduction.
  • Includes essays on Charlotte Haldane, Katherine Burdekin, Maureen Duffy, Gwyneth Jones, Ursula Le Guin, Doris Lessing, C. L. Moore, etc.
